Output 39eabcd2c6f9f3a94e9b6c98c3043040b189845998249df6a00271531824451d:0

value
18587309140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e724438e16d6c50a165322960c2599c306d6d07a OP_EQUAL
address
MUyKmQGjm1GGosNCWriEaJSijBVa9voH6q
transaction
39eabcd2c6f9f3a94e9b6c98c3043040b189845998249df6a00271531824451d
spent
true